**09:14 — GC pause storm begins.** Matchline's pairing service on the Oakbend cluster started stalling for 4–8 seconds per collection. Cause: a config push doubled the candidate cache, blowing past heap headroom. 09:31: cache size reverted, pauses cleared by 09:38. Contractor note: never bump cache sizes on this service without checking heap charts first; it runs hot by design. The reverted deployment is identifiable by the build token below.

build token for kagaf-hahof: htk14_9d3d4d26d7d8de

Handover note — Crumbwheel order cutoffs.

Welcome aboard. The bakery cutoff rule in Crumbwheel closes same-day orders at 14:00 local to each storefront, not UTC — this has bitten us twice. Holiday overrides live in the calendar service and take precedence silently, so always check there first when a cutoff looks wrong. To unlock the calendar service's admin console after a restart, enter the recovery passphrase below.

vault phrase of bagap-bahaf = silion-pelox-sorox-casdor-quenwyn-fraax-eliox-praael-kelion-quenvan-kasox-rusael-norius-belvan

# Versioning notes for the Lanternkit shared component library.
# Lanternkit follows strict semver, but minor bumps occasionally ship
# schema changes to the component registry table, so never pin to a
# range wider than the current minor. If the registry drifts from the
# deployed bundle version, the Pellwright dashboard renders blank
# panels. Verify the registry version before rolling back any release.
# The registry is reached via the connection string below.

primary connection of yagep-kahip = redis://giliel_svc:zYiKsLL2PLpfPL@db-348f.xolmarsys.corp:5432/fenwyn

- [ ] **Step 7: Breaker override escrow.** After sealing the signing keys for the Tallgrove upstream API circuit breaker, confirm the support team can force the breaker open during a full outage. The override bundle lives in the sealed escrow drawer and is useless without its unlock phrase. Two ceremony witnesses must initial this step before proceeding. The escrow bundle is decrypted with the recovery passphrase that follows.

vault phrase of kahip-kahop = holath-quenmir